Oklahoma City Community College is seeking a Math Resource Center Aide - Student to support daily operations and assist students and faculty in the Math Resource Center.
The role requires a current OCCC student enrolled in minimum hours and may include evening/weekend shifts. You will greet and assist visitors, help with check-ins, and handle clerical tasks in a busy campus lab.

Current OCCC student enrolled in a minimum of 6 hours for the Fall or Spring semester or enrolled in a minimum of 3 hours for the Summer semester. OR Current OCCC student with a Federal Work Study Award.

Work schedule will range from 20 – 25 hours per week and may include evenings and Saturdays depending on Math Resource Center operational requirements. Schedules are set each semester and will respect the student’s class schedule.
